Output 38f14521acfa53d84d888deef03e1180a1f14bce62461033f0f3d783278fd6a9: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cbc61d36aeb77cfe98ee3e48344631a8cfcb61 OP_EQUAL
address
3KT18DWVH9ySRNoJNoXpJ5op3b59AZxzFw
transaction
38f14521acfa53d84d888deef03e1180a1f14bce62461033f0f3d783278fd6a9
spent
true